Publisher's Description

A Handbook for Relieving the Discomforts of Pregnancy

Massage is a sensuous, relaxing, and loving treatment that has the added bonus of being especially good for you. It’s the perfect way to reduce stress and promote general well-being. During pregnancy, your body is undergoing many changes, some of them stressful and discomforting. Mother Massage, by licensed massage therapist Elaine Stillerman, is a beautifully illustrated guide to help eliminate some of these adverse effects. Designed to be used either alone or with a partner, Mother Massage provides techniques for a variety of massages, including full body massage, preparation for labor and birthing massage, massage during the postpartum and nursing stages, and infant massage. These techniques are explained in step-by-step, illustrated detail. You’ll also learn special massages for treating such discomforts as:

• Backaches
• Breast Soreness
• Charley Horse and Leg Cramps
• Headaches
• Heartburn
• Fatigue
• Morning Sickness
• Sciatica
• Stretch Marks
• Varicose Veins
• And Many Others

Also included are sections on reflexology, herbal remedies, and nutritional requirements for pregnant and lactating women.

Author Bio

Elaine Stillerman, a licensed massage therapist in New York City, has been specializing in prenatal and postpartum massage since 1980 and has worked with hundreds of expectant women. She has written many articles on massage therapy and teaches the nationally certified course “Mother Massage: Massage During Pregnancy” at massage schools all over the country. She is also the author of The Encyclopedia of Bodywork (1996).

Diana Kurz is a painter who has exhibited her work nationally and internationally. She is a recipient of a Fulbright grant for art and has taught in universities and art schools all over the world.
